About Nerderburg
The Nederburg is from Paarl, in the Western Cape of South Africa. NedeWine was one of the earliest wineries to bring international fame to South Africa. The first International Winemaker award was won by the South Africa wine making company at the International wine & Spirit Competition in London in 1985. Recently, it was given five star rating by the South African Wine tasting board. This makes it one of the best wines in the region. The Nederburg wine is reputed to have a pedigree of excellence to wine lovers home and abroad. The Nederburg wine is also the official wine of the 2010 world cup.
